On May 5, 2015, she became a contestant on JYP's newest survival show, SIXTEEN. Unfortunately, on episode 6, she was eliminated for her relatively weak vocals, compared to the other trainees. However, based on a unanimous decision, JYP, along with the trainers and the A&R team, bought her back and included her in the final line-up.
They officially debuted on October 20, 2015 with their first mini album, The Story Begins. Controversy arose as fans became skeptical of the motivations behind this decision. Later, a representative from JYPE stated that "Momo is exceptional in dance and performance.
We believed that she will be a great addition to really complete TWICE. " The following day after the final episode, JYPE released a short statement about the addition of Tzuyu and Momo into the final lineup of the group: "We apologize for failing to clearly communicate the selection process, and we'd like to explain it in detail once again. The condition to be chosen as a final member was the votes made by the audience and viewers.
However, leading up to the final episode, we thought that the seven members selected officially may leave something to be desired. So, in addition to the seven, we decided that one member would be added solely from viewer's opinions (Tzuyu) and one from solely Park Jin Young's opinion (Momo). " On June 24, a representative of Mnet released a statement confirming Momo's appearances on Mnet's newest survival show, Hit the Stage, as a contestant.
JYP Entertainment announced on February 9, 2023, that Momo, along with fellow members Sana and Mina, would debut as MiSaMo, Twice's Japanese subunit. MiSaMo released their debut EP, Masterpiece, on July 29.
